355. 设计推特

合并k个有序链表的应用


# 模拟时间戳
timestamp = 0
import heapq

class Twitter:
    """
    355. 设计推特
    https://leetcode.cn/problems/design-twitter/description/
    """
    def __init__(self):
        """初始化,创建一个字典,用于userId和user对象的映射"""
        self.userMap = {}

    def postTweet(self, userId: int, tweetId: int) -> None:
        """用户userId发表一条tweet"""
        if userId not in self.userMap:
            self.userMap[userId] = self.User(userId)
        u = self.userMap[userId]
        u.post(tweetId)

    def getNewsFeed(self, userId: int) -> List[int]:
        res = []
        if userId not in self.userMap:  # 如果不存在 userId 则返回空结果列表
            return res
        users = self.userMap[userId].followed
        # 用最大堆存储所有关注列表的 Tweet,时间复杂度 logN
        pq = []
        for id in users:
            twt = self.userMap[id].head
            if twt:
                # 将time取相反数作为堆的排序值,使其成为最大堆
                heapq.heappush(pq, (-twt.time, twt))

        # 检查队列中是否有Tweet的时间最晚或已经取到10个Tweet的时候退出
        while pq and len(res) < 10:
            _, twt = heapq.heappop(pq)
            res.append(twt.id)
            if twt.next:
                # 将一个用户发布的下一个Tweet放入最大堆中对其排序
                heapq.heappush(pq, (-twt.next.time, twt.next))

        return res

    def follow(self, followerId: int, followeeId: int) -> None:
        """用户followerId关注用户followeeId"""
        if followerId not in self.userMap:
            u = Twitter.User(followerId)
            self.userMap[followerId] = u

        if followeeId not in self.userMap:
            u = Twitter.User(followeeId)
            self.userMap[followeeId] = u

        self.userMap[followerId].follow(followeeId)

    def unfollow(self, followerId: int, followeeId: int) -> None:
        """用户followerId取消关注用户followeeId"""
        if followerId in self.userMap:
            flwer = self.userMap[followerId]
            flwer.unfollow(followeeId)

    class Tweet:
        def __init__(self, id: int, time: int):
            # 需要传入推文内容(id)和发文时间
            self.id = id
            self.time = time
            self.next = None

    class User:
        # 用户类,包含用户关注的人、推文的链表头结点、用户 ID
        def __init__(self, userId: int):
            self.id = userId
            self.followed = set()  # 用户关注的人
            self.head = None  # 推文的链表头结点
            self.follow(self.id)  # 关注自己

        # 用户关注一个人
        def follow(self, userId: int):
            self.followed.add(userId)

        # 用户取消关注一个人
        def unfollow(self, userId: int):
            # 不可以取关自己
            if userId != self.id and userId in self.followed:
                self.followed.remove(userId)

        # 用户发表一条推文
        def post(self, tweetId: int):
            global timestamp  # 全局时间戳,保证推文各不相同
            twt = Twitter.Tweet(tweetId, timestamp)
            timestamp += 1  # 时间戳自增
            # 将新建的推文插入链表头
            # 越靠前的推文 time 值越大
            twt.next = self.head
            self.head = twt
